Advert

  • Greenfields Community Primary School is looking for an experienced and knowledgeable support worker for our extended provision. We are seeking candidates who have experience of extended schools provision, providing a safe, caring and stimulating environment for all children. Experience working with children is essential.
  • It is preferred that you hold a C grade or above at GCSE in English and Maths.
  • It is desirable that the sucessful candidate holds a level 3 qualification related to Early Years.
  • The working hours will be 7.15am-9.15am and 2.30pm-6pm every school day, term time only. The clubs run from 7.15am-8.45am and 3.15pm-6pm each day.
  • Visits to school are highly recommended.

 

The successful candidate will 

  • Fully commit to working alongside the Extended Schools Manager team to ensure the best possible provision for all children.
  • Be accountable for our breakfast and after school clubs and will be responsible for resource ordering, activity planning and food preparation. This role will report directly to the Extended Schools Manager.
  • Support the development of relevant polices and practice.
  • Promote the school’s core values at all times (Wellbeing, Aspiration, Resilience, Uniqueness and Teamwork).
  • Be a passionate play practitioner who enjoys using creative and innovative approaches to play activities.
  • Work closely and build effective relationships with parents and carers.

Information about the school

Greenfields is an oversubscribed one and a half form entry Community Primary School with 3 nursery classes. The school is situated in South Maidstone on a large site with amazing facilities.

We have designed our own curriculum to meet the needs of our children. This includes dedicated enrichment funding and use of the school’s minibuses to bring our curriculum to life e.g. regular trips to London, Harry Potter Studios, chances to explore all areas of Kent and much more!

We have become well known for our dedication to PE and school sport and are proud to have set up sporting opportunities for children across Maidstone. This has been recognised by us receiving the Platinum Sports Award.
